The Fontanas are back, which means one thing: it's time to party. 

Rooted in soul and soaked in funky Latin & Brazilian influences, The Fontanas inhabit the irresistible sweet spot between tight funk grooves and swinging rhythms. The band will be performing tracks from their new record, The Fontanas Live, drawing influence from the likes of The Dap Kings and Banda Black Rio. Catch them for this special party as they trailblaze across the festival circuit this summer.

Esme Emerson will be performing as the opening act, starting at 7pm.
